Frequently Asked Questions about the 99352 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 99352?

There are currently 14 Studio Apartments in 99352 with rent ranges from $850 to $1,955 with an average price of $1,388.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 99352 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 99352 ranges from $901 to $3,159 with an average monthly rent of $1,797.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 99352 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 99352 range from $1,107 to $3,433.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,055.

How expensive are 99352 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 34 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 99352 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,278 to $4,821 - averaging $1,991 for the location.
